#4c418d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c418d is composed of 29.8% red, 25.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 53.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 248.7 degrees, a saturation of 36.9% and a lightness of 40.4%. #4c418d color hex could be obtained by blending #9882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4c418d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c418d has RGB values of R:76, G:65,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4997517.

Shades and Tints of #4c418d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040307 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fc is the lightest one.
